The IST programme initiative on 2.5-3G mobile applications and services K. Rouhana NCP meeting

Overview of the presentation The context The context The need for specific actions on 2.5 3G applications and services The need for specific actions on 2.5 3G applications and services Call 7 Bis: A pan European trials initiative Call 7 Bis: A pan European trials initiative Next steps Next steps

The need for a specific action IPPA 3 identified a weakness IPPA 3 identified a weakness –Dispersed and limited coverage of 3G services The 3G Communication recommends an effort The 3G Communication recommends an effort ISTAG WG7 recommends an effort ISTAG WG7 recommends an effort A first consultation meeting on May 3 A first consultation meeting on May 3 –Operators, manufacturers, service providers –Broad support for a specific action A wider consultation meeting, May 29 A wider consultation meeting, May 29 –200 registered in two weeks –Broad support and interest in a specific action

Consultations results The current effort needs to be intensified The current effort needs to be intensified –To extend scope and volume and consolidate effort The need for a two phase approach The need for a two phase approach –Solve urgent issues hindering uptake –Address longer term developments Testing environments not easily available Testing environments not easily available –multi-networks, multi-operators, terminals.. European interoperability, a key hurdle European interoperability, a key hurdle –Pan-European roaming,..

Three types of actions envisaged Clustering of existing projects to improve impact Clustering of existing projects to improve impact –Clusters exist for transport, tourism, core technologies –Need for cross programme clusters addressing Pan European roaming, Payment systems, Security, etc..Pan European roaming, Payment systems, Security, etc.. Testing environments for applications and services Testing environments for applications and services –A specific initiative for enabling the testing at a pan European level of applications and services RTD on new mobile applications/services RTD on new mobile applications/services –Consolidated action across sectors –A CPA in WP2002

Call 7 bis: Objectives Test and validate Test and validate –2.5 G and 3G applications and services at a Pan European level Address critical issues hindering deployment Address critical issues hindering deployment Bring actors together Bring actors together – Service providers- operators-manufacturers – Support SMEs in taking risk

Issues to be addressed Interoperability/inter-working Interoperability/inter-working –feasibility of pan-European services with different operators, handsets, portals, gateways, –roaming issues (in particular from 2.5G to 3G networks) Billing and payment issues Billing and payment issues –micro-payments, business model –consistency of data billing Safety, security and QoS aspects Safety, security and QoS aspects Consider migration from IPv4 to IPv6 Consider migration from IPv4 to IPv6

Possible applications location based, personalised and context-sensitive services location based, personalised and context-sensitive services navigation and guidance, traffic and traveller information, logistics, and virtual presence navigation and guidance, traffic and traveller information, logistics, and virtual presence m-commerce/m-business and mobile work applications and services m-commerce/m-business and mobile work applications and services Mobile enter-/infotainment, mobile learning, mobile access to cultural heritage and m-advertising. Implementation Focussed on Trials of 2.5-3G applications & services. Focussed on Trials of 2.5-3G applications & services. Budget ~25 M Euro Budget ~25 M Euro Focused set of small number of projects Focused set of small number of projects Service providers, operators, manufacturers, users, Service providers, operators, manufacturers, users, Exploit synergies with existing industry initiatives Exploit synergies with existing industry initiatives Launch as early as possible Launch as early as possible Projects duration less than 18 months Projects duration less than 18 months

Planning A special IST Call in early September 2001 A special IST Call in early September 2001 –Opinion of Committee in July 2001 –Commission decision in August/early September –Call launch 4 September (tentative date) Information day: 19 September Information day: 19 September Deadline and evaluation in December 2001 Deadline and evaluation in December 2001 Contracts signed in February/early March 2002 Contracts signed in February/early March 2002

The CPA action in 2002 Build integrated solutions Build integrated solutions –Combine wireless technologies (LANs + 3G, etc..) –Multi-sensorial interfaces into devices –exploit IPv6 possibilities New mobile applications and services New mobile applications and services –Entertainment, m-Commerce, transport and mobility, health,… Complements work on core technologies Complements work on core technologies Interoperability and interworking Interoperability and interworking An integrated action as a pilot towards FP6 An integrated action as a pilot towards FP6
